A guide to brunch in Ireland

Breakfast might be the most important meal of the day, but brunch is definitely the most fun. Not quite breakfast but too early for lunch, the brunch meal has become a weekend staple in recent years. Whether you’re making it a bottomless boozy one or a quiet catchup one, it’s always the ideal way to kickstart any day. To celebrate the most popular meal of the day, we’re taking a look at Ireland’s best places for brunch.

Overlooking the canal of Harold’s Cross, Southbank is a friendly neighbourhood cafe serving up leisurely breakfasts and indulgent brunches. The dog-friendly venue offer an all-day menu including scrambled eggs with feta cheese and lime creme fraiche on toasted sourdough, pancakes with hokey pokey butter and crispy bacon, avocado toast with smokey tomato sauce, and the classic full Irish, as well as plenty of toasted sandwiches, fresh fruit and yoghurt options, and a wide range of fresh pastries. Opt in for a mimosa set for 2 alongside your morning coffee to kickstart your day!

There’s nothing better than a European breakfast, and Nine in Wicklow is serving up just that! The French cafe-bistro offers an all-day menu with the likes of fresh berry French toast with vanilla cream, truffled wild mushrooms on sourdough toast, corned beef and potato hash with hollandaise sauce, and a chorizo breakfast burrito with all the trimmings. Add on a cup of coffee and perhaps a mimosa if you’re feeling cheeky, and enjoy your trip to France at Nine!

Burzza
cuisinesItalian, American, Brunch
Fine organic Italian flour, fresh yeast, slow proving dough, organic Italian tomatoes – this is the staple for all food at Burzza. Toppings are sourced from artisan Italian and Irish suppliers, while the dough is made in-house and traditionally formed. The food’s then cooked Neapolitan style in a traditional wood-fired oven. Brunch is served on the weekend 12-3pm, with highlights including Tom Kearney’s slow cooked beef ragu, a mouthwatering selection of pizzas and signature burgers and fries. The cocktails here are superb too, especially the Caramel Martini.
The Treehouse Bar & Restaurant
cuisinesIrish, Brunch

Situated at the starting point of the Wild Atlantic Way and the Inishowen 100, The Treehouse provides quality locally sourced food at a reasonable price. There’s an exciting bottomless brunch menu served Wednesday to Saturday 12-5pm, and served all day Friday to get the weekend going. It’s all about the wings here with Asian Style Sticky Wings a very popular choice or Hot & Spicy Wings if you’re feeling brave.

The River Bar & Restaurant
cuisinesBrunch, Irish

The River Bar & Restaurant is a stylish place to meet for a riverside brunch setting. It’s also perfectly located right in the heart of Limerick city centre! An award-winning AA rosette restaurant, this is a popular place all thanks to the Executive Chef and his culinary team who all pride themselves in serving the finest quality Irish cuisine, with an emphasis on fresh, seasonal produce and where possible an emphasis on using locally produced products.

Oahu is an all day brunch venue serving professionally brewed specialty coffee. Oahu (Hawaiian: Oʻahu), means “The Gathering Place”, which is fitting. The all day brunch menu boasts a homemade soup of the day, banana toast, avocado toast, egg tortilla and more. If you’re very hungry then go for the Oahu Breakfast: two eggs (poached, fried or scrambled), bacon, sausage, black pudding, beans, grilled vine tomato and sourdough. A Full Veggie is also available.

The SpitJack Rotisserie Brasserie
cuisinesIrish, Brunch
The SpitJack Rotisserie Brasserie in Cork serves locally sourced, quality produce, all cooked on the rotisserie. This is an upmarket, all day brasserie that serves breakfast, brunch/lunch and dinner. Among the brunch cocktails is the legendary Spitjack Bloody Mary, made with Dingle Vodka, the restaurant’s own ’Mary Mix’, fresh lemon and tomato juice. As for the food, expect international flavours such as falafel on toast and huevos rancheros, alongside the SpitJack Classic: honey glazed rotisserie ham, two poached eggs, bacon dust, toasted sourdough, and traditional hollandaise sauce.

Crawford & Co
cuisinesBrunch, Burgers

Crawford & Co has the perfect location, a mere three minute skip from Cork city centre. Home of the infamous Crawford bottomless brunch, it’s become so famous it’s now regarded Cork’s number one bottomless brunch venue! Try the signature brunch dishes every Saturday and go bottomless if you feel like adding some bubbles. Available 12-4pm, you can choose from delicious dishes such as waffle, southern fried chicken, streaky bacon and organic maple syrup, or BBQ pulled pork bap with garlic mayo, slaw, fried egg, rocket salad and chips.

Clancys has gained a reputation as one of Cork’s best entertainment venues, offering high quality drinks made by talented mixologists, casual dining ranging from breakfast to dinner, and some of the best live music acts that city has to offer. The historical significance of the pub is maintained in the décor, which displays Irish sporting memorabilia and All-Ireland medals collected throughout the decades. The Full Irish here is outstanding; it comes with two sausages, two pudding, one bacon, egg, beans, mushrooms, hash brown and toast, so arrive hungry.

HYDE Bar & Gin Parlour
cuisinesCocktails, Brunch

HYDE Bar is an exciting addition to the Galway social scene; an elegant and stylish gin bar in Galway City Centre, it stocks over 450 gins from around the world! The brunch here is among the best. The Brioche French Toast is amazing, while the American Style Pancakes are incredible. It’s the Spiced Chicken Blaaguette we’re here for though. Moroccan spiced chicken with roasted peppers, spinach leaves, toasted nuts and seeds, maple and chilli dressing, and crispy fries – it’s just… brilliant, in a word.
